Postcode SM4 5QX is located in a major urban area, within the Lower Morden ward of Merton in the London region, and forms part of the St Helier North area. It has high deprivation and average crime levels, with around 58.8 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 55% below the London average of 130 per 1,000. The average income per household in St Helier North is £65,627 per year. The nearest station is Morden South, about 0.3 miles away. There are 9 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, the closest large park is Morden Park.
